Airalo Developer Platform
Guides
Copy Page
Airalo Developer Platform
OVERVIEW
Introduction
Partner with Airalo
Attribute descriptions
FAQ
User journeys
Purchase journey
Top-up journey
Guides
How to set up a brand for eSIMs Cloud link sharing
How to get the eSIMs Cloud sharing link through API
How to generate the QR code for an eSIM
eSIM installation methods for API Partners
REST API
Introduction
Rate limits
Error handling
Guides
Step #1 - Authentication
Quick start
Request access token
Get packages
Submit order
Get installation instructions
Endpoints
Orders List
Get order list
Get order
Top-up flow
Get eSIMs list
Get top-up package list
Get eSIM package history
Notification
Understanding Webhooks: Asynchronous Communication for Modern Applications
Airalo Webhooks Optin and Flow
Async orders
Low data notification - opt In
Low data notification - opt out
Get low data notification
Credit limit notification
Webhook definition
Webhook simulator
Balance
Get balance
under development
Request access token
Get compatible device list
Get packages
Submit order
Submit order async
Submit top-up order
Get eSIM
Get data usage
Get installation instructions
Update eSIM brand
eSIM voucher
Refund Request
Future Orders
Cancel future orders
Deprecated
Authentication
Request Access Token
Orders
Get Order List
Get Order
Submit Order
Submit Top-up Order
eSIMs
Get eSIMs List
Get eSIM
Get Installation instructions
Get Data Usage
Get Top-up Package List
Get eSIM Package History
Order Statuses
Get Order Statuses List
Get Order Status Name
Packages
Get Packages
Compatible Devices
Get Compatible Device List
Notification
Low Data Notification
Credit Limit Notification
Webhook Definition
Webhook Simulator
SDKs
Introduction
SDK vs. REST API
Technical notes
WOOCOMMERCE PLUGIN
Introduction
Guides
How to install the plugin
How to setup the Shop price?
Customizing "My eSIM" page colors in WooCommerce
How to convert prices into local currency
How to finalize the shop setup
How to test in sandbox
How to go live
Customizing WooCommerce email templates for eSIM sales
Troubleshooting
Guides
Copy Page
How to test in sandbox
Once syncing, payment gateway setup (in test mode), pricing, and local currency conversion are complete, you’re ready to start testing in the sandbox.
1
Perform test purchases on behalf of test customers, trying different payment methods:
Purchase a single eSIM.
Purchase multiple eSIMs, selecting different packages within the same country or across various countries and regions.
2
Review the test results
Verify that the email sent to customers includes the My eSIM link and that the eSIMs can be installed following the instructions.
Check the content of the email.
Confirm the pricing:
Ensure prices meet your expectations.
Verify prices are correctly converted to your local currency.
Modified at
2024-12-17 16:30:06
Previous
How to finalize the shop setup
Next
How to go live